Transaction 63e02ecdbd41aa622a5c0747b8230e8b0a9b8546f8ac17f17f5465c889c4366a
1 Input
1 Output
-
63e02ecdbd41aa622a5c0747b8230e8b0a9b8546f8ac17f17f5465c889c4366a:0
- value
- 5077361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d31918390aa645bd1bd60dfcc60915aa5891bbe OP_EQUAL
- address
- MU4iwu4jaqdepPkdbXsLvXxPmqt9ya3Qkq